Report: Hamas rejected Israeli offer to release 40 hostages for week's truce

|
The Wall Street Journal reported that Hamas rejected an Israeli offer to stop fighting in the Gaza Strip for a week in exchange for the release of 40 hostages. According to the report, which is based on Egyptian sources, the terrorist organization stated that it will not discuss the release of Israeli hostages until the cease-fire comes into effect. (Ynet)
